Samsung Rolls Out One UI 6.1 Update Across Multiple Galaxy Devices

Samsung has released the One UI 6.1 update for the Galaxy Tab S7 FE, available in Korea for Wi-Fi, LTE, and 5G variants. This update, identified by build numbers T733XXU6DXE1, T735NKOU5DXE1, and T736NKOU5DXE1, is the first for a pre-2022 Samsung tablet. Users can download it via the tablet's settings or by using a PC. The Galaxy Tab S7 FE will not receive Android 15, with its final update likely being One UI 6.1.1.

OnePlus Pad debuts in US market at $479 to compete with Samsung tablets.

OnePlus has launched its first-ever Android tablet, the OnePlus Pad, in the US and Canada. Priced at $479 in the US and $649 in Canada, the tablet features an 11.61-inch display with a resolution of 2,800 x 2,000 pixels, a 144Hz variable refresh rate, and a 13MP rear camera. It is powered by the MediaTek Dimensity 9000 processor and runs on Android 13 OS and OxygenOS 13.1 customization. The tablet will compete directly with Samsung's Galaxy Tab S7 FE, which costs $449 for the 128GB storage option.
